2024 年日本 PHP 研討會

dbase_get_record

(PHP 5 < 5.3.0, dbase 5, dbase 7)

dbase_get_record 從資料庫中取得一條記錄作為索引陣列

說明

dbase_get_record(資源 $database, 整數 $number): 陣列

從資料庫中取得一條記錄,並以索引陣列的形式返回。

參數

database

資料庫資源,由 dbase_open()dbase_create() 返回。

number

記錄的索引,介於 1dbase_numrecords($dbase_identifier) 之間。

返回值

包含記錄的索引陣列。此陣列還包含一個名為 deleted 的關聯鍵,如果記錄已被標記為刪除(參見 dbase_delete_record()),則該鍵值設為 1。

每個欄位都會轉換為適當的 PHP 類型,但以下例外:

  • 日期保留為字串。
  • 日期時間值會轉換為字串。
  • 超出 PHP_INT_MIN..PHP_INT_MAX 範圍的整數會以字串形式返回。
  • 在 dbase 7.0.0 之前,布林值 (L) 會轉換為 10

發生錯誤時,dbase_get_record() 將返回 false(假)。

更新日誌

版本 說明
PECL dbase 7.0.0 database 現在是 資源,而不是 整數

參見

新增註記

使用者貢獻的註記

此頁面沒有使用者貢獻的註記。
To Top